Abstract

This final report describes the working principle instrument detector glucose level using glucose strip sensor based on fuzzy logic. This final report the author aims to knowing working principle instrument detector glucose level using fuzzy logic program as a data processor glucose values. Working principle of this instrument are when glucose strip sensor inserted and spilled blood then glucose level will reacting so that producing electron signal flowing through circuit electrode producing electrical signal that very small, therefore the need for amplifier circuit invade by ADC microcontroller ATMEGA 32. Next, the ADC input will be processed by program using fuzzy logic with sugar level reference provision in the blood. Then the output will be displayed with numbers on the first LCD for glucose level result with the provision that if the condition of the fasting blood glucose of <100 mg / dl means normal, if the condition of the fasting blood glucose of 100-128 mg / dl means pre-diabetes, and if the condition of the fasting blood glucose of >128 mg / dl means diabetes. Furthermore, if the blood sugar condition moment of <140 mg / dl means normal, if the blood sugar condition moment of 140-200 mg / dl means pre-diabetes, and if the blood sugar condition moment of >200 mg / dl means diabetes. Then displaying the output on second LCD the result from fuzzy microcontroller program for glucose level in the blood category that’s read on glucose level indicator in the blood.
